Escalating Tensions: Iran and Afghanistan Clash Over Water Dispute

In a distressing turn of events, Iran and Afghanistan find themselves embroiled in a heated cross-border conflict, fueling already simmering tensions between the two nations. The dispute centers around water rights, specifically concerning Iran’s access to the vital Helmand River….